Types of Visa Sponsorship Finance Jobs in Dubai:

Visa sponsorship is a prevalent practice for expatriate employees in Dubai, particularly within the finance sector, which provides a range of positions that qualify for such sponsorship. Several prevalent categories of finance employment in Dubai encompass:

  • Financial Analyst: A financial analyst systematically assesses financial data to deliver insights and recommendations aimed at enhancing a company’s financial performance. This position is frequently offered within large corporations, financial institutions, and investment firms.
  • Accountant: Professionals in the field of accounting in Dubai are responsible for managing financial records, preparing tax documentation, conducting audits, and generating financial reports. This position is in great need across multiple sectors, including retail, hospitality, and construction.
  • Investment Banker: Employment opportunities in investment banking within Dubai are highly appealing to individuals possessing expertise in corporate finance, mergers and acquisitions (M&A), and capital markets. Numerous international investment institutions maintain a presence in Dubai.
  • Risk Manager: Risk managers evaluate and mitigate financial risks associated with business operations. Financial institutions and multinational corporations in Dubai are in pursuit of professionals adept at navigating intricate risk landscapes.
  • Financial Controller: Financial controllers are responsible for supervising accounting operations and ensuring that financial reports adhere to regulatory standards. This role is prevalent within large corporations and multinational enterprises headquartered in Dubai.
  • Insurance Specialist: As Dubai’s insurance market continues to expand, there is an increasing demand for professionals possessing expertise in underwriting, claims processing, and risk management.
  • Tax Consultant: Tax consultants in Dubai offer advice on tax planning, compliance, and strategy for enterprises and individuals. This position is crucial for both multinational corporations and local businesses.

Requirements:

  • Education: The predominant fields of study include finance, accounting, business, and economics, with certain employers favoring candidates who possess a Master of Business Administration (MBA) or a Master’s degree in a related discipline.
  • Certification: CFA, ACCA, CIMA, or CPA which is highly in demand and increases competitiveness
  • Work Experience: Previous experience in the finance sector is highly regarded by employers in Dubai, with a minimum of three years typically correlating with a senior-level position.
  • Technical Proficiencies: Proficient in financial analysis software and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ems, complemented by advanced capabilities in spreadsheet applications.
  • Language Proficiency: Proficiency in English is essential. In the case of Arabic speakers, it will be preferred but not mandatory.

Salaries:

  • Financial Analyst: AED 120,000 – AED 200,000
  • Accountant: AED 80,000- AED 150,000
  • Finance Manager: AED 180,000 -AED 300,000
  • Investment Banker: AED 300,000-AED 600,000
  • Financial Consultant: AED 150,000 – AED 250,000

How to Apply For Visa Sponsorship Finance Jobs in Dubai?

  • Target Organizations that Provide Visa Sponsorship: The largest corporations, financial institutions, and investment firms present the most promising prospects for obtaining visa sponsorship for professionals in Dubai. The utilization of employment platforms and professional networking sites: Finance employment opportunities in Dubai can be sourced through platforms such as LinkedIn, GulfTalent, Bayt, and Naukrigulf. Networking opportunities are available through platforms such as LinkedIn or through participation in industry events.
  • Customize the resume to align with the specific job opportunity, highlighting your relevant skills, certifications, and experience pertinent to the position. For any of the aforementioned positions, please emphasize any international experience, as this consistently offers a significant advantage for employment opportunities based in Dubai.
  • Preparation for Pre-Visa Sponsorship: If your position is visa-sponsored, it is highly probable that your employer will oversee the management of the employment visa in the United Arab Emirates. Please ensure that you have your degree certificates, relevant certifications, and all documents pertaining to your work experience readily available.
  • Follow-up: Upon submitting your application, it is advisable to follow up via email or LinkedIn to express your interest, particularly if you have established a connection with a recruiter or recruiting manager.
